Output 25fa1c755fef60cdc0559dee2568f5cea7ff6105e0efb2c62dffd656c789cc7f:0

value
69469
script pubkey
OP_0 OP_PUSHBYTES_20 6fdd27913ca780e1519ea47dd6f7ecf943c563cc
address
bc1qdlwj0yfu57qwz5v7537adalvl9pu2c7vv5uncx
transaction
25fa1c755fef60cdc0559dee2568f5cea7ff6105e0efb2c62dffd656c789cc7f
confirmations
3518
spent
true